In Muay Thai, and to learn martial arts in general, building a solid foundation for your technique is very important. In class to learn martial arts you should focus on doing the drills correctly and getting the proper repetition in so you can develop good habits. This is especially important for students at the beginning level. Developing correct technique in the beginning of your martial arts journey, when you first begin to learn martial arts, will save you a lot of time and energy in the long run. Retraining improper technique and trying to get rid of bad habits that you developed is a very tedious and annoying process. For me personally I developed a bad habit of raising my chin when I throw combinations. This developed for me from hitting pads with my chin raised (despite the constant reminders I received by my instructors to do otherwise). I didn’t think it was that important to keep my chin down while hitting pads. Because of this over time my body got use to my chin being at a certain level as I throw combinations, and now when I go on the offensive when I spar my chin slightly raises leaving me vulnerable to counters. Keeping my chin down is something I have to constantly think about in order to retrain the improper technique I developed. Believe me, I know it could be tedious and sometimes boring to go slow and focus on developing your skills in class, but martial arts is a life long journey. There is no rush. Taking your time to properly drill will pay off an unbelievable amount in the long run.
